DOS (Disk Operating System) og shell er to tæt beslægtede begreber i computerverdenen, men de har forskellige roller og funktioner:
1. DOS:
- DOS er en type operativsystem, der var almindeligt brugt i personlige computere før den udbredte anvendelse af grafiske brugergrænseflader (GUI'er).
- Det er et kommandolinjebaseret operativsystem, hvilket betyder, at brugere interagerer med computeren ved at skrive kommandoer ved en kommandoprompt.
- DOS giver grundlæggende filhåndtering, programafvikling og andre væsentlige funktioner til styring af en computers ressourcer og kørsel af applikationer.
- Eksempler på DOS-operativsystemer omfatter MS-DOS, som er udviklet af Microsoft, og DR-DOS, udviklet af Digital Research.
2. Shell:
- En shell er en brugergrænseflade, der giver brugerne mulighed for at interagere med operativsystemet.
- I DOS er skallen en kommandolinjefortolker, også kendt som en kommandoprocessor eller kommandoprompt.
- Når du åbner et DOS-vindue eller en kommandoprompt, interagerer du med DOS-skallen.
- Skallen giver den tekstbaserede grænseflade til at indtaste og udføre kommandoer til at udføre forskellige opgaver, såsom oprettelse af mapper, kopiering af filer og lancering af programmer.
- Nogle populære skaller inkluderer MS-DOS-kommandoskallen (COMMAND.COM) i DOS, Bourne-skallen (sh) i Unix og Windows PowerShell i moderne Windows-operativsystemer.
3. Forhold:
- DOS er styresystemet, mens skallen er brugergrænsefladen, der giver brugerne mulighed for at interagere med styresystemet.
- Skallen giver midlerne til at indtaste og udføre kommandoer, mens DOS håndterer de underliggende opgaver og processer baseret på disse kommandoer.
Sammenfattende er DOS operativsystemet, der giver den grundlæggende funktionalitet af en computer, mens skallen er brugergrænsefladen, der giver brugerne mulighed for at interagere med operativsystemet ved at indtaste kommandoer.